Brandy Mueller (Democratic Party) is a judge of the Texas 403rd District Court. She assumed office on January 1, 2023. Her current term ends on December 31, 2026.

Mueller (Democratic Party) won election for judge of the Texas 403rd District Court outright after the general election on November 8, 2022, was canceled.

Selection method

See also: Partisan election of judges

Judges of the county courts are elected in partisan elections by the county they serve and serve four-year terms, with vacancies filled by a vote of the county commissioners.[3]

Qualifications
To serve on a county court, a judge must:[3]

  • be at least 25 years old;
  • be a resident of his or her respective county for at least two years; and
  • have practiced law or served as a judge for at least four years preceding the election.
